Cloudways for WordPress – Cloud-Based Managed Hosting Review

Cloudways takes a fundamentally different approach to WordPress hosting compared to traditional managed platforms. Rather than operating its own server infrastructure, Cloudways functions as a managed layer that sits on top of multiple Infrastructure-as-a-Service providers — allowing users to deploy WordPress on DigitalOcean, Linode (now Akamai), Vultr, Amazon Web Services, or Google Cloud Platform through a unified management interface. This model gives users the raw performance and scalability of cloud VPS servers without requiring the systems administration expertise typically needed to manage those servers directly.

The Cloudways approach appeals to a specific segment of WordPress users: those who need more performance than shared hosting provides but who do not want to manage server infrastructure manually. Traditional managed WordPress platforms like WP Engine and Kinsta abstract away the server entirely, providing a polished but opaque hosting experience. Cloudways occupies a middle ground where users select their own cloud provider and server specifications while Cloudways handles server provisioning, security patching, stack optimization, and maintenance tasks. This combination of choice and management creates a hosting experience that warrants detailed examination.

Multi-Cloud Architecture

The defining characteristic of Cloudways is its multi-cloud model. When creating a new server, users choose from five cloud infrastructure providers, each with different performance profiles, pricing structures, and geographic coverage. This choice has meaningful implications for hosting cost, server performance, and data center location options.

DigitalOcean servers on Cloudways provide a balance of performance and cost that makes them popular for small to medium WordPress sites. DigitalOcean’s SSD-based droplets deliver consistent performance at predictable pricing, with data center locations spanning North America, Europe, Asia, and Australia. For WordPress sites that do not require enterprise-grade infrastructure, DigitalOcean through Cloudways represents one of the most cost-effective managed WordPress hosting configurations available.

Vultr High Frequency servers offer enhanced single-core performance through higher clock speed processors, which benefits WordPress workloads that are largely single-threaded during PHP execution. The performance improvement over standard cloud instances can be noticeable for WordPress sites with significant dynamic content generation — WooCommerce stores, membership sites, and sites running complex theme logic see measurable improvements in page generation times on higher-frequency processors.

AWS and Google Cloud options on Cloudways provide access to the most extensive global infrastructure networks available. AWS offers data center locations across virtually every major geographic region, while Google Cloud provides access to its premium-tier network that routes traffic over Google’s private backbone. These options carry higher pricing compared to DigitalOcean and Vultr but offer enterprise-grade reliability, extensive geographic coverage, and access to the broader ecosystem of cloud services offered by each platform.

Linode (now part of Akamai) rounds out the infrastructure options with competitive pricing and solid performance across its global data center network. The integration of Linode into Akamai’s infrastructure has expanded its capabilities and network reach, providing an interesting option for sites that benefit from Akamai’s extensive CDN and edge computing network.

Server Stack and WordPress Optimization

Regardless of the underlying cloud provider selected, Cloudways deploys a consistent optimized server stack for WordPress hosting. The stack includes Nginx as the primary web server, Apache as a secondary handler for compatibility with certain WordPress configurations that rely on .htaccess rules, PHP-FPM for efficient PHP processing, and MySQL or MariaDB for database operations.

Cloudways implements multiple caching layers that work together to optimize WordPress performance. At the server level, Varnish Cache acts as a reverse proxy, storing full-page HTML responses in memory and serving them to subsequent visitors without involving PHP or the database. Varnish configuration on Cloudways is pre-optimized for WordPress, with cache invalidation rules that automatically purge cached content when posts are published, updated, or when WordPress settings change.

Redis object caching is available on all Cloudways servers and handles the caching of database query results and WordPress object cache entries. When WordPress generates a page, it makes dozens of database queries — many of which return the same data on every page load. Redis stores these query results in memory, reducing database load and accelerating page generation. For sites with complex WordPress configurations, the database load reduction from Redis caching can be substantial.

Memcached is also available as an alternative object caching backend for sites that prefer it over Redis or for specific plugin compatibility requirements. The flexibility to choose between Redis and Memcached at the server level distinguishes Cloudways from managed platforms that make these decisions on behalf of users.

PHP version management on Cloudways allows users to select and switch between supported PHP versions per application. This granularity is useful for agencies managing multiple WordPress sites with different PHP compatibility requirements on the same server. Upgrading PHP versions can deliver measurable performance improvements — PHP 8.x processes WordPress requests significantly faster than PHP 7.x — and Cloudways makes version switching a non-disruptive process that takes effect within minutes.

Application Management

Cloudways organizes hosting around the concepts of servers and applications. A single server can host multiple WordPress applications, each with its own domain, database, SSL certificate, and configuration. This multi-application model allows users to consolidate multiple WordPress sites on a single server, sharing the server’s resources across all applications. The cost efficiency of this model increases with each additional application, since server costs remain fixed regardless of how many applications are deployed.

Each WordPress application on Cloudways can be managed independently through the platform’s dashboard. Application-level settings include domain management, SSL certificate provisioning through Let’s Encrypt, database access credentials, file manager access, and application-specific caching configuration. Staging environments can be created per application, providing a sandboxed copy for testing changes before deploying to production.

The Cloudways dashboard provides server-level monitoring that tracks CPU usage, memory consumption, disk I/O, and bandwidth utilization in real time. These metrics help identify when a server is approaching its resource limits and may need to be scaled up. Unlike traditional shared hosting where resource limits are enforced silently, Cloudways gives users visibility into their actual resource consumption and the ability to respond proactively.

Scaling and Resource Management

Vertical scaling on Cloudways involves upgrading the server to a larger instance with more CPU cores, memory, and storage. This process can be initiated through the dashboard and typically completes within minutes, though it requires a brief period of downtime as the server instance is migrated to larger hardware. The ability to scale resources on demand means that users can start with smaller, less expensive servers and upgrade as their sites grow, avoiding the need to over-provision resources from the beginning.

Horizontal scaling — distributing traffic across multiple servers — is not handled natively by the Cloudways platform. Sites that need horizontal scaling typically implement external load balancing solutions or use Cloudflare’s load balancing features to distribute traffic across multiple Cloudways servers. For most WordPress sites, vertical scaling provides sufficient capacity, but high-traffic sites with specific availability requirements may need to architect multi-server solutions independently.

Server cloning allows users to create exact copies of existing servers, including all applications, configurations, and data. This feature is useful for creating staging environments at the server level, testing infrastructure changes before applying them to production servers, or quickly deploying preconfigured server templates for new client sites. Cloned servers operate independently of the original, with their own IP addresses and billing.

Security Features

Cloudways implements security measures at both the server and application levels. At the server level, operating system patches and security updates are applied automatically by Cloudways, keeping the underlying Linux environment current without requiring manual intervention. Dedicated firewalls filter incoming traffic, and IP whitelisting capabilities allow administrators to restrict SSH and database access to specific IP addresses.

Application-level security includes Cloudways Bot Protection, which uses behavioral analysis to distinguish between legitimate visitors and malicious bot traffic. This system operates similarly to web application firewalls, analyzing request patterns and blocking automated traffic that matches known attack signatures. Two-factor authentication is available for the Cloudways dashboard, adding an additional layer of protection against unauthorized account access.

SSL certificate management is handled through automated Let’s Encrypt integration. Users can provision free SSL certificates for each application with a few clicks, and certificate renewal happens automatically before expiration. For organizations requiring Extended Validation or Organization Validation certificates, Cloudways supports custom SSL certificate installation.

Automated backups run on configurable schedules, with retention periods that can be adjusted through the dashboard. Backup frequency options range from hourly to weekly, and each backup captures the complete application environment including files and database. On-demand backup creation is also available for creating manual restore points before significant changes. Backup storage uses the underlying cloud provider’s storage infrastructure, and download options allow keeping offline backup copies for additional safety.

Pricing Model

Cloudways uses a pay-as-you-go pricing model based on the server specifications selected, billed hourly with monthly summaries. There are no long-term contracts, setup fees, or lock-in periods — servers can be launched and destroyed as needed with billing calculated to the hour. This model contrasts sharply with traditional hosting providers that require annual or multi-year commitments for the best pricing.

Server pricing varies by cloud provider and instance size. The most affordable entry point is a DigitalOcean server with 1GB RAM, which provides a capable environment for hosting one or two small WordPress sites. Pricing scales upward with larger server specifications, with the highest-tier options providing dedicated CPU cores, substantial memory allocations, and generous storage.

An important distinction in Cloudways’ pricing model is that server costs cover multiple applications. A single Cloudways server can host numerous WordPress installations, with the total cost remaining the same regardless of application count. This makes Cloudways particularly cost-effective for agencies and freelancers managing multiple client sites, as consolidating sites onto shared servers reduces the per-site hosting cost significantly.

Cloudways charges additional fees for certain premium features and add-on services. Email hosting is not included and requires third-party email services. Cloudflare Enterprise CDN integration is available as a paid add-on that provides enhanced performance and security features beyond what free Cloudflare plans offer. Premium support upgrades provide faster response times and dedicated assistance for organizations requiring higher support service levels.

Migration and Onboarding

Cloudways provides a free WordPress migration plugin that automates the process of transferring existing WordPress sites to the Cloudways platform. The plugin handles file transfer, database migration, and search-replace operations for updating URLs in the database. For straightforward WordPress installations, the migration plugin completes the transfer process with minimal manual intervention.

Sites with complex configurations — multisite networks, custom server-level configurations, or non-standard WordPress setups — may require additional manual steps during migration. Cloudways offers free expert migration assistance for the first site on new accounts, with additional professional migration services available for a fee. The migration team handles complex transfers including database optimization, file structure adjustments, and post-migration testing.

Developer and Agency Features

Cloudways provides several features oriented toward developers and agencies managing multiple sites. SSH and SFTP access allows direct server interaction for deployment, debugging, and configuration tasks. Git integration supports deployment workflows where code changes pushed to a repository are automatically deployed to the server, enabling continuous deployment pipelines for WordPress theme and plugin development.

The Cloudways API provides programmatic access to server and application management functions, enabling automation of provisioning, configuration, and monitoring tasks. Agencies can integrate Cloudways management into their existing tooling and workflows through API-driven automation. Team management features allow assigning role-based access to team members, controlling who can manage servers, applications, and billing within an organization.

White-label capabilities on specific plans allow agencies to present Cloudways-hosted sites under their own branding, without Cloudways branding visible to end clients. This feature supports agency business models where hosting is bundled as part of website management services offered to clients.

Limitations and Considerations

  • Learning curve: Cloudways’ server-management orientation introduces concepts like server sizing, PHP worker configuration, and caching layer selection that may be unfamiliar to users accustomed to traditional shared hosting.
  • No email hosting: Email hosting is not included and must be provisioned through external services such as Google Workspace, Microsoft 365, or other dedicated email providers.
  • Manual scaling: Server scaling requires manual intervention — Cloudways does not auto-scale servers in response to traffic spikes. Sites expecting viral traffic or unpredictable demand spikes need monitoring and manual scaling response.
  • Limited domain registration: Cloudways does not offer domain registration services. Domains must be registered and managed through separate domain registrars.
  • Variable performance by provider: Performance characteristics differ meaningfully between the five cloud provider options, and selecting the appropriate provider requires understanding each provider’s strengths and limitations.

WordPress-Specific Capabilities

While Cloudways supports multiple PHP applications beyond WordPress, the platform has invested in WordPress-specific capabilities that enhance the WordPress hosting experience. The Cloudways WordPress Migrator plugin, Breeze caching plugin, and WordPress-specific server optimizations reflect the platform’s recognition that WordPress represents a significant portion of its user base.

Breeze is Cloudways’ free WordPress caching plugin, designed to work seamlessly with the server-level caching stack. Breeze handles WordPress-specific caching tasks including page caching, minification of CSS and JavaScript files, Gzip compression, and browser caching header configuration. Because Breeze is designed for Cloudways’ server environment, it avoids the compatibility conflicts that can arise when general-purpose caching plugins interact unpredictably with server-level caching systems. The plugin integrates with Varnish Cache to manage cache purging when WordPress content changes, ensuring that visitors always see current content.

WooCommerce hosting on Cloudways benefits from the platform’s flexible resource allocation. Because users control their server specifications, WooCommerce stores experiencing growth can scale server resources to meet increasing demand. Redis object caching is particularly beneficial for WooCommerce, as it reduces the database query overhead generated by product catalogs, shopping carts, and order processing. Cloudways’ server monitoring tools help identify when WooCommerce-related traffic is approaching server capacity limits, enabling proactive scaling before performance degrades.

WordPress multisite network hosting is supported on Cloudways, with server-level configurations that enable subdomain or subdirectory multisite installations. Each site within a multisite network shares the server resources of the parent application, making Cloudways’ scalable server model well-suited for multisite deployments that need room to grow. The platform’s SSH access and WP-CLI support facilitate efficient multisite management for administrators comfortable with command-line operations.

Summary

Cloudways addresses a genuine gap in the WordPress hosting market — the space between managed platforms that abstract away all infrastructure decisions and unmanaged VPS hosting that requires full systems administration expertise. By providing a managed layer over multiple cloud providers, Cloudways offers flexibility in infrastructure selection, transparent resource allocation, and cost-efficient multi-site hosting.

Cloud-based WordPress hosting providers like Cloudways, Kinsta, WP Engine, and Flywheel each serve different hosting philosophies. Cloudways appeals to users who want visibility into and control over their hosting infrastructure while offloading server management tasks. The platform’s multi-cloud model, pay-as-you-go pricing, and multi-application hosting structure make it worth evaluating alongside traditional managed WordPress platforms, particularly for agencies, developers, and growing businesses that need scalable hosting without the complexity of direct server administration.

The platform’s ability to host multiple WordPress applications on a single server, combined with competitive pricing from providers like DigitalOcean and Vultr, creates a cost structure that can be significantly more affordable than per-site managed hosting plans for users managing multiple websites. However, this cost advantage comes with trade-offs in convenience — users need to make more infrastructure decisions and manage their server resources more actively compared to fully managed alternatives.
